What the CFPB Complaint Record Shows for Vanderbilt Mortgage & Finance, Inc

The CFPB Consumer Complaint Database has logged 781 complaints against Vanderbilt Mortgage & Finance, Inc overall, with 118 of those filed in the trailing 12 months. Reports have come from consumers in 41 states and territories, making this a nationwide complaint footprint. The single largest complaint category is "Mortgage," which consistently leads the product-level breakdown and signals where consumer friction is most acute. Within that category, the most frequently cited specific issue is "Struggling to pay mortgage" — a useful starting point for anyone trying to understand what goes wrong most often in the company's consumer interactions.

Vanderbilt Mortgage & Finance, Inc's timely response rate stands at 99.5%, meaning that share of CFPB-forwarded complaints received a company reply within the 15-day window the Bureau expects. That figure is at or above the industry benchmark and suggests the company's intake and escalation processes are functioning as designed. Consumers formally disputed the company's response in 16.1% of resolved cases, a signal of how often the initial resolution failed to satisfy the complainant. Of complaints that were resolved, 1% closed with some form of monetary or non-monetary relief to the consumer.

Complaint counts alone do not tell the full story — larger institutions with more customers will naturally generate more complaints in absolute terms. The more informative signals are the direction of the yearly trend shown above, the state-level concentration (which hints at regional servicing issues or regulatory exposure), and the ratio of monetary-relief closures to closed-without-relief outcomes. Taken together, these fields give consumers a reasonable empirical basis for deciding whether to escalate a dispute, and give researchers a starting point for investigating institutional patterns.
